Metropolitan Magazine Wins Launch Of The Year 2011 At The BSME Awards


Ink, the  leaders in travel media connecting companies with travellers, is pleased to announce that Metropolitan Magazine has won the “Launch of the Year” at the 2011 British Society of Magazine Editors (BSME) Awards. Published by Ink for Eurostar, Metropolitan is a monthly magazine that was launched in May 2010.

With a readership of over 600,000, Metropolitan is distributed on all Eurostar trains between London and Paris and London and Brussels, and is also available in the business lounges at each station. Offering big engaging reads, beautiful design and striking photography, Metropolitan is trilingual, with content in English, French and Flemish. The magazine eschews covering the same old travel-writing ground, seeking to reveal a different side to Eurostar’s destination cities with fresh stories and alternative perspectives. The tone is smart, sophisticated and cultured with a healthy dose of wit and humour in the mix.

“We are thrilled to have our work recognised by the rest of the industry, especially competing against newsstand publications,” said Metropolitan’s editor, Jane Wright. “Working with such a prestigious brand as Eurostar sets the bar very high for producing original, engaging and thought-provoking content. We have been delighted with the reaction from Eurostar, its passengers and our peers.”
